It is with great sadness we announce the passing of our father and grandfather, Henry McIntosh, 70, on April 2, 2018 at the Cape Breton Regional Hospital surrounded by his loving family. Born in New Waterford, he was the son of the late Terrance and Marguerite (Hennessy) McIntosh.
He had a passion for horses, having at one time worked at Woodbine Race Track as a stable hand, as well as helping his friends who had race horses here. He also worked in the local mines.
